The overprint applied to the Wiesbaden stamps bears the word “Regierung”, or “government”, and can be found in three types, with Type II being the most common and Type III the rarest.



In addition, 4 ink colors are known:
Not all values can be found in all 4 colors.
25 different stamps are known to have been overprinted, in a mixture of ink colors and overprint types. The total number of currently known combinations of is approximately 137.
